Please Wait...
06:30AM
30mins
09:15AM
45mins
09:30AM
10:00AM
10:30AM
Cardiovascular
A dance inspired fitness craze that shows no sign of stopping., inspired by latin American dance moves and choreographed to a varied range of music such as spanish and latin
11:30AM
17:45PM
18:30PM
60mins
18:45PM
19:30PM